1. Start with a Solid Foundation 🪵
Before you go wild with sails and turbines, make sure your island can handle the weight.
- Use Wood Beams and Supports to create a stable platform
- Keep your core structures centred to maintain balance
- Reinforce long bridges or upper decks with angled beams
Pro Tip: Build around your island’s core rock mass, it provides the most stability for heavy machinery later.
2. Learn the Language of the Wind 🌫️
The wind direction in Aloft constantly shifts. Understanding it is key to efficient design.
- Look for floating particles or flags to gauge direction
- Build wind compasses for accurate readings
- Plan your structures so sails and windmills always face open air
Bonus Tip: Avoid placing wind structures near tall walls, blocked airflow reduces efficiency dramatically.
3. Build Your First Sails ⛵
Sails are the earliest form of wind harnessing.
- Use Wood, Cloth, and Rope to craft basic sails
- Mount them on rotatable joints for adjustable positioning
- Connect them to winches or anchors for mobility
You’ll unlock Advanced Sails later, which can move your island or power mechanical contraptions.
4. Upgrade to Windmills and Turbines ⚙️
Once your base expands, it’s time to convert raw wind into usable power.
- Windmills generate steady rotational energy
- Turbines output higher power but require careful alignment
- Place multiple mills at varying heights to catch different wind layers
Pro Tip: Build elevated towers, wind flow is stronger higher up, especially during storms.
5. Powering Your Island 🔌
Connect turbines and sails to machines using the island’s wind grid system.
- Power Crafting Stations, Workbenches, and Lights
- Store excess energy in battery nodes
- Use switches or levers to reroute power efficiently
Keep your circuits simple. Overloading your network with too many connections can reduce output and cause instability.
6. Designing Efficient Bases 🏗️
The most successful sky bases balance form and function.
- Keep wind structures on outer decks or towers
- Store heavy materials near the island’s centre
- Leave open airflow paths between structures
Aloft rewards smart design, well-planned layouts look stunning and perform better under changing conditions.
Bonus Tip: Combine wind power with glider docks and elevators to create seamless, moving sky hubs.
7. Weather and Maintenance 🌪️
Storms can both help and harm your systems.
- Wind speeds increase during storms, use that boost for crafting
- But strong gusts can damage sails or tilt structures
- Inspect machinery regularly and repair damaged components
If you’re hosting a shared world, schedule maintenance breaks, nothing kills immersion like your windmill flying off mid-storm.
8. Go Fully Mobile 🚀
Once your island is well powered and balanced, you can take to the skies.
- Install directional sails or thrusters
- Adjust ballast and weight for stability
- Use control stations to steer your island across biomes
This is the pinnacle of Aloft engineering, turning your base into a skyship that drifts wherever the wind calls.
